Starbucks Launches Ready-to-Drink Iced Latte

Starbucks expands its ready-to-drink category with new iced latte.

Starbucks launched the Caffè Latte in 1984, back when Americans were unfamiliar with the drink, and soon it became a fan favorite. Now the brand is introducing a new way to drink and enjoy the beverage to customers with its ready-to-drink Starbucks Iced Latte, according to a recent QSR Magazine article. For a limited time, the Salted Caramel Mocha single-serve ready-to-drink iced latte will be available to consumers.

Starbucks' ready-to-drink category has grown to be more than $2 billion in retail with its North American Coffee Partnership with PepsiCo that started more than 20 years ago. The bottled Frappuccino has seen a lot of success over the years as a chilled coffee drink for consumers on-the-go.

Coffee lovers can also enjoy the Caffè Latte at home with K-Cup pods, Starbucks VIA Instant and Caffè Latte Verismo pods.
